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:50 mins
Total Time:65 mins
Servings: 8

Ingredients

  • 2 cups All-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ons Ba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 1 teaspoon Ground nutmeg
  • 0.5 teaspoon Ground cinnamon
  • 1 cup Granulated sugar
  • 0.5 cup Unsalted butter (softened)
  • 2 large Eggs
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 1 cup Eggnog
  • 0.5 cup Powdered sugar
  • 2 tablespoons Eggnog (for glaze)
  • 0.25 teaspoon Ground nutmeg (for garnish)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ly grease a 9x5-inch loaf pan and set it aside.

Step 2

In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, salt, nutmeg, and cinnamon until well combined. Set aside.

Step 3

In a large bowl, cream together the sugar and butter using a hand mixer or stand mixer until light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es.

Step 4

Add the e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ition. Mix in the vanilla extract.

Step 5

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ture in three additions, alternating with the cup of eggnog (beginning and ending with the dry ingredients). Mix until just combined, being careful not to overmix.

Step 6

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and smooth the top with a spatula.

Step 7

Bake for 50-55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the bread comes out clean.

Step 8

Remove the bread from the oven and let it cool in the pan for 10 minutes. Then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 9

To make the glaze, whisk together the powdered sugar and 2 tablespoons of eggnog in a small bowl until smooth.

Step 10

Once the bread is completely cool, drizzle the glaze over the top and sprinkle with ground nutmeg for garnish.

Step 11

Let the glaze set for a few minutes before slicing and serving. Enjoy your festive Christmas Eggnog Bread!
